当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

怎么把项目部署到tomcat服务器里,深入解析,从零开始,手把手教你将项目部署到Tomcat服务器

怎么把项目部署到tomcat服务器里,深入解析,从零开始,手把手教你将项目部署到Tomcat服务器

从零开始,本教程将深入解析如何将项目部署到Tomcat服务器。手把手教学,涵盖配置环境、创建Web应用、打包部署等关键步骤,助你轻松掌握项目部署全过程。...

从零开始,本教程将深入解析如何将项目部署到Tomcat服务器。手把手教学,涵盖配置环境、创建Web应用、打包部署等关键步骤,助你轻松掌握项目部署全过程。

随着互联网的快速发展,Web应用开发已经成为IT行业的重要方向,Tomcat作为一款轻量级的Java应用服务器,因其稳定、高效的特点,在Web应用开发中得到了广泛的应用,本文将详细讲解如何将项目部署到Tomcat服务器,帮助读者快速掌握这一技能。

准备工作

1、下载Tomcat:我们需要从Apache官网下载Tomcat的最新版本,下载完成后,将其解压到指定目录。

2、下载项目源码:将你的项目源码下载到本地,确保项目结构完整。

怎么把项目部署到tomcat服务器里,深入解析,从零开始,手把手教你将项目部署到Tomcat服务器

3、配置环境变量:在系统环境变量中添加Tomcat的bin目录,以便在命令行中直接运行Tomcat。

项目部署步骤

1、创建Web应用目录

在Tomcat的webapps目录下创建一个以项目名称命名的文件夹,myproject。

2、将项目源码打包成war文件

使用Maven或Gradle等构建工具将项目源码打包成war文件,以下是使用Maven进行打包的示例:

mvn clean package

执行上述命令后,在项目的target目录下会生成一个名为war包的文件。

3、将war包复制到Web应用目录

将打包好的war包复制到Tomcat的webapps目录下。

4、修改web.xml配置

怎么把项目部署到tomcat服务器里,深入解析,从零开始,手把手教你将项目部署到Tomcat服务器

在war包的WEB-INF目录下找到web.xml文件,修改其中的配置,以下是web.xml配置示例:

<web-app>
  <display-name>myproject</display-name>
  <servlet>
    <servlet-name>MyServlet</servlet-name>
    <servlet-class>com.example.MyServlet</servlet-class>
  </servlet>
  <servlet-mapping>
    <servlet-name>MyServlet</servlet-name>
    <url-pattern>/myServlet</url-pattern>
  </servlet-mapping>
</web-app>

5、启动Tomcat服务器

在命令行中,进入Tomcat的bin目录,执行以下命令启动Tomcat服务器:

startup.bat

(Windows系统)

startup.sh

(Linux系统)

6、访问项目

在浏览器中输入Tomcat服务器的地址,http://localhost:8080/myproject/,即可访问部署好的项目。

项目调试与优化

1、调试

怎么把项目部署到tomcat服务器里,深入解析,从零开始,手把手教你将项目部署到Tomcat服务器

在开发过程中,可能会遇到各种问题,以下是一些常见的调试方法:

(1)查看日志:Tomcat的logs目录下包含了大量日志文件,可以帮助我们找到问题的根源。

(2)使用调试工具:如Eclipse、IntelliJ IDEA等IDE,可以在项目中设置断点,方便调试。

2、优化

(1)性能优化:针对项目中的性能瓶颈,进行代码优化、数据库优化等。

(2)安全性优化:加强项目安全性,防止SQL注入、XSS攻击等。

(3)资源优化:优化图片、CSS、JavaScript等资源,提高页面加载速度。

本文详细讲解了如何将项目部署到Tomcat服务器,通过学习本文,读者可以掌握项目部署的基本流程,为后续的Web应用开发打下坚实基础,在部署过程中,注意调试和优化,以确保项目稳定、高效运行。

黑狐家游戏

发表评论

最新文章